Griffin is 60"and 55#@28". Tamo ash veneers and the riser is coco I think. Limbs are bamboo core, super smooth and lightning quick!

The Blacktail is Snakewood w/Ebony, Myrtle Limbs with  myrtle jewel inlays on the riser. It is 62", 50#@28".

I  have always stayed the course to Silvertips so for me this was a leap of faith! I am please to say the least--So much so a few Silvertips perished to get these two fine pieces of art  :)
